The story is extremely predictable with very little entertainment value. The characters are very one dimensional and don’t ring true as they are frequently indistinguishable in action. Even the cat trying to ponce on a bug during the climax is lackluster due to the over formulaic nature, poor dialogue, and overdrawn nature. Being formulaic isn’t the issue with the book, it’s the lack of creativity and differentiation.
Don’t bother with this book.

First a review of the story- this futuristic setting for this world is poorly conceived frequently relying on modern elements and assuming 0 advancements while at other times massive leaps In tech and references to a dystopian future. The plot is fairly plain with a couple holes and a few side plots that are partially built. One consistently confusing parts is the setting of various scenes which you are plunged into and only find out later where they are.
The narrator is extremely nasally and over enunciated that has the same effect of 60 grit sandpaper being used to shave. She’s intelligible and clear but the cost is too high.
